When consumption of a good by one person does not prevent consumption by another, a. there is an external cost. b. there is a ne

twork externality. c. consumption is nonrival. d. There is free ridership.

Answer:

The correct answer is letter "C": consumption is nonrival.

Explanation:

Rival goods are those whose consumption is allowed to one individual. Rival goods are durable because they are to be used one at the time or nondurable since they perish. Nonrival goods, on the other hand, <em>are those publicly shared by individuals and their demand is not an influencing factor in their consumption. </em>National defense, street lights or public safety are examples or nonrival goods.

A marketing manager had a goal to improve market share for his paper plates by 2 percent in the coming year, and he felt he’d ne
rodikova [14]

Answer:

OBJECTIVE AND TASK BUDGETING.

Explanation:

Objective and task budgeting is an effective budgeting strategy which considers the firm’s overall promotional objectives. The budgeting is then done according to the requirements for meeting these goals.

By running television ads and a social media campaign, the marketing manager has created a means to meet his objective or goal which is to improve market share for his paper plates by 2 percent in the coming year. He then proceeds to price how much the advertising would cost him and then sets the budget. This budgeting is done by OBJECTIVE AND TASK BUDGETING. This allows the marketing manager to allocate a certain amount of money to its marketing budget based on his objectives, rather than choosing an arbitrary amount.
